Overview

Handmade copper represents a fusion of traditional metalworking techniques and artistic expression. Artisans shape copper sheets or casts through hammering, engraving, and patination processes that have been refined over centuries. Unlike mass-produced copper items, handmade pieces showcase unique imperfections that add character. In contemporary markets, handmade copper serves both functional and aesthetic purposes. From Moroccan tea sets to Nepalese singing bowls and European architectural details, regional styles reflect local cultural heritage. The material's durability ensures these pieces often become heirlooms.

Product Features

Copper's natural antimicrobial properties make it ideal for kitchenware and hospital fixtures. The metal develops a distinctive greenish patina (verdigris) when exposed to moisture, which many artisans accelerate for decorative effects through chemical treatments. Workability is another key characteristic – copper can be cold-worked without annealing until it hardens. This allows for intricate repoussé (embossed) designs. Modern artisans often combine copper with other metals like brass or pewter for visual contrast and improved durability.

Main Uses

High-end hospitality industries frequently commission custom copper bars, backsplashes, and light fixtures for their warm glow and vintage appeal. Religious institutions use copper for ceremonial objects due to its symbolic association with purity in many cultures. In residential settings, handmade copper sinks and bathtubs have gained popularity in luxury bathrooms. Smaller items like coasters, vases, and jewelry cater to boutique retail markets. Industrial designers also incorporate artisanal copper elements into modern furniture pieces.

Culture and Development

The craft flourished during China's Ming Dynasty (1368–1644), particularly for Buddhist statues and temple gongs. In Europe, the Arts and Crafts movement (1880–1920) revived interest in handmade copper amid industrialization. Today, UNESCO recognizes several copper craftsmanship traditions as Intangible Cultural Heritage. Contemporary makers balance preservation of techniques with innovation. Some workshops now combine CNC machining for basic shapes with hand-finishing, while purists maintain entirely manual methods. The global artisan movement has created new markets through platforms like Etsy and specialized trade fairs.

B2B Procurement Guide

Bulk buyers should verify the workshop's production capacity and lead times – complex pieces may require months. Request material certificates for alloy compositions, especially for food-contact items needing lead-free copper. Sample testing for finish durability (like salt spray tests) is advisable for outdoor installations. Shipping requires special packaging to prevent denting, with climate-controlled containers recommended for humid regions to avoid premature patina formation. Some governments offer import duty exemptions for handmade cultural goods – check Harmonized System code 7419.99 for applicable regulations.
